feat(plat/arm/sgi): read isolated cpu mpid list from sds

Add support to read the list of isolated CPUs from SDS and publish this
list via the non-trusted firmware configuration file for the next stages
of boot software to use.

Isolated CPUs are those that are not to be used on the platform for
various reasons. The isolated CPU list is an array of MPID values of the
CPUs that have to be isolated.

+/*
+ * Information about the isolated CPUs obtained from SDS.
+ */
+struct isolated_cpu_mpid_list {
+	uint64_t num_entries; /* Number of entries in the list */
+	uint64_t mpid_list[PLATFORM_CORE_COUNT]; /* List of isolated CPU MPIDs */
+};
+
+/* Function to read isolated CPU MPID list from SDS. */
+void plat_arm_sgi_get_isolated_cpu_list(struct isolated_cpu_mpid_list *list)
+{
+	int ret;
+
+	ret = sds_init();
+	if (ret != SDS_OK) {
+		ERROR("SDS initialization failed, error: %d\n", ret);
+		panic();
+	}
+
+	ret = sds_struct_read(SDS_ISOLATED_CPU_LIST_ID, 0, &list->num_entries,
+			sizeof(list->num_entries), SDS_ACCESS_MODE_CACHED);
+	if (ret != SDS_OK) {
+		INFO("SDS CPU num elements read failed, error: %d\n", ret);
+		list->num_entries = 0;
+		return;
+	}
+
+	if (list->num_entries > PLATFORM_CORE_COUNT) {
+		ERROR("Isolated CPU list count %ld greater than max"
+		      " number supported %d\n",
+		      list->num_entries, PLATFORM_CORE_COUNT);
+		panic();
+	} else if (list->num_entries == 0) {
+		INFO("SDS isolated CPU list is empty\n");
+		return;
+	}
+
+	ret = sds_struct_read(SDS_ISOLATED_CPU_LIST_ID,
+			sizeof(list->num_entries),
+			&list->mpid_list,
+			sizeof(list->mpid_list[0]) * list->num_entries,
+			SDS_ACCESS_MODE_CACHED);
+	if (ret != SDS_OK) {
+		ERROR("SDS CPU list read failed. error: %d\n", ret);
+		panic();
+	}
+}
